LSA with HLTA Experience

Job Introduction

LSA with HLTA experience (with some lunchtime supervisory duties)

Closing date Midday 17th March 2026

Interview date 25th March 2026

Job start date ASAP 

Contract Fixed term full time (28 hours a week) term time only 

Salary type support staff Grade B £24,796 - £25,128 pa pro rata (Dependant on experience) with HLTA uplift 

Lunchtime Supervisors shifts paid at Grade A £12.56 an hour.

Hours of work 8.45am - 3.15pm Monday-Friday. 

Lunchtime supervisor (as required) term time only

 

We are seeking to appoint a highly motivated LSA to work 28 hours a week in our friendly and supportive Key stage 2 team. The duties will be split between working with groups/individuals in class, organising and leading intervention strategies for small groups/individuals outside of the classroom. 

 

Alongside the role of LSA you will have the opportunity to work part time as an  HLTA, paid at an uplifted rate,  to cover absences, intervention teaching and PPA cover when required. 

 

You will need to be flexible, creative and easily able to adapt to the changing needs of our busy school.

 

You will be joining a dynamic, passionate and progressive group of teachers who strive to gain the maximum from our rich curriculum to support our children.
